Perferably maybe walking distance or something that wont require us to bring a car seat for the little one so bus or water taxi? As well Nassau is a pier correct? Nassau is a pier. Carseats are basically unheard of in the Bahamas... child would sit on YOU. Hilton (BCH) is near for around $15pp (walking distance) and many shops are right off the ship. Jitneys (buses) will take you to Sheraton/Wyndham complex for $1pp each way. Can be caught in town.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
